The Morristown Cultural District threw a holiday party on Saturday — its first Theatre of Light, on the Vail Mansion lawn.
Despite sub-freezing temperatures, a crowd gathered to hear the Mayo Performing Arts Company sing holiday tunes.
Morristown High School junior Bobbi Baitey’s rendition of Stevie Wonder’s Someday at Christmas was among the evening’s highlights. Check out our video:

Baitey’s sister, Aja, is a past member of the performing arts company. She’s studying musical theater at Pace University.
Saturday’s festivities followed a free screening of The Grinch next door at the Mayo Performing Arts Center.
The Morristown Cultural District consists of MPAC, the Morristown & Township Library, the Presbyterian Church in Morristown, St. Peter’s Episcopal Church and the Jockey Hollow Bar & Kitchen.

Library Director Chad Leinaweaver and Presbyterian Church Pastor David Smazik said they are hopeful that special lighting can illuminate their downtown area year-round, with colors changing by season.
